About Promo.com

Promo.com is a web-first video creation service focused on social ads and short-form social content. Born out of the Slidely team and positioned as a template-driven video maker, Promo’s core value proposition is to reduce time-to-ad by combining editable templates, licensed media, music licensing, and automated production steps. The company emphasizes marketing use cases—video ads, promo clips, and social posts—rather than complex timeline editing. Promo is aimed at business users who need compliant music and stock footage plus a simple workflow to produce platform-optimized videos quickly.

Promo.com’s feature set centers on four practical capabilities. First, its template library and editor let users swap text, clips, and logos into thousands of prebuilt templates and render variants for multiple aspect ratios in one project. Second, Promo provides a licensed media library (Promo states a large catalog of premium clips and images) and commercially cleared music tracks that can be added per video for ad use. Third, AI-assisted features include an auto-caption tool and a script-to-video helper that suggests scenes based on entered copy. Fourth, distribution tools enable direct publishing to Facebook, Instagram and TikTok and offer downloads at platform-ready resolutions; users can also apply a brand kit (logo, colors, font) to keep outputs consistent.

Pricing is tiered with a freemium entry point and paid monthly plans for heavier use. The free tier allows trial projects with watermarked exports and limited downloads. Paid monthly plans unlock HD exports, watermark removal, larger download quotas, and team seats. Promo also offers business/agency pricing that adds multi-user seats, priority support, and higher monthly export quotas; enterprise customers can request custom contracts and SSO. Users pay more to access additional licensed music downloads, advanced team management, and higher render quotas for ad campaigns.

Promo.com is used by social media managers and small marketing agencies to convert campaign ideas into platform-optimized video ads quickly. Example users include a Social Media Manager using Promo to produce 30 platform-optimized ad variants per month, and an Ecommerce Marketing Lead using it to create product promo clips for paid campaigns. For teams that need more granular timeline editing or native design tools, Promo is often compared with Canva (which combines graphic design and video editing in a single workspace). Promo leans more toward stock-driven ad creation, whereas Canva focuses on broader creative editing features.

Promo.com Pricing Plans

Current tiers and what you get at each price point. Verified against the vendor's pricing page.

Plan Price What you get Best for
Free Free Watermarked exports, low download quota, basic templates only Individuals testing platform or single-use projects
Starter $49/month HD exports, 25 downloads/month, single seat, no agency features Solo marketers who need regular HD posts
Pro $149/month 250 downloads/month, multi-seat (3), brand kit, priority support Small teams and agencies running frequent campaigns
Agency Custom High export quotas, multi-seat admin, SSO and invoice billing Larger teams requiring volume and enterprise features

How to Use Promo.com

  1. 1
    Open the Create Video flow
    Sign in and click the prominent Create a Video (or New Video) button on the dashboard. This opens Promo’s template browser so you can start from an ad template, saving time versus a blank project.
  2. 2
    Pick a template and aspect ratio
    Filter templates by goal (e.g., Facebook Ad) and choose the required aspect ratio (square, vertical, landscape). Selecting a template preloads scenes and recommended clips for quicker edits.
  3. 3
    Customize text, clips, and brand kit
    Use the editor to replace placeholder text, swap stock clips, upload your logo, and apply your Brand Kit. Success looks like on-screen previews matching your brand colors and messaging.
  4. 4
    Generate captions and export or publish
    Enable Auto-captioning, pick music from the licensed library, then click Export or Publish to send directly to Facebook/Instagram/TikTok or download your 1080p file.
